London, August 20, 2008 – J.P. Morgan announced today that its GlobeClearsm business will now offer third party clearing for Warsaw Stock Exchange (WSE) members who wish to trade Polish securities. J.P. Morgan will be providing clearing and settlement capabilities to clients who want to transact in equities and fixed income products on the WSE. This latest offering marks the 23rd exchange supported directly by J.P. Morgan GlobeClearsm.
Additionally, J.P. Morgan announced that its first client went live on the WSE with J.P. Morgan GlobeClearsm on 5 August 2008.

About the Warsaw Stock Exchange
With 366 listed companies and an equity market capitalization of EUR 230 billions,
the Warsaw Stock Exchange (WSE) is one of the best developed and dynamic markets
in Central Europe in terms of capitalization, trading volume, number and type
of traded instruments, as well as organizational and technological solutions
used.
